Answer in brief
CVE-2026-60137 records a Critical severity (CVSS 9.1) sql injection vulnerability in WordPress Core SQL Injection Vulnerability. The source record marks it as known exploited. No package mapping is present, so exposure must be confirmed against the affected product and deployment inventory.

Review the upstream advisory, identify the affected product in your inventory, and apply the vendor update when one is available.
SQL Injection describes the vulnerability class recorded for this advisory. NVD marks CVE-2026-60137 as known exploited, so exposure review should be prioritized. This is a product-level record in the current feed, not a package-level dependency mapping.
Affected software not mapped. Review the upstream record for vendor-specific product and version guidance.
WordPress Core contains a SQL injection vulnerability when a plugin or theme passes untrusted input to the parameter. This vulnerability can be chained with CVE-2026-63030 to allow an unauthenticated attacker to gain remote code execution on default WordPress installations.
